People invented carpets because the floors were too cold for their feet, but in time this problem solved and nowadays many people buy carpets mostly for decorative purposes. That is the case with this strange shoelace carpet that is made of … shoelaces. It is pretty unusual and these shoelaces are not even tied to one another or woven together, but simply piled up in a somehow ordered pile . This shoelace carpet that you can see in the picture for example is meant to be black and white and it has an interesting design, having an equal proportion of black and white shoelaces.

The shape and color of the carpet is in constant flux, because the long laces are constantly moving, of course, once the carpet is incorporated into everyday life. The version in black and white is the standard design, if desired be used but other colors and a unique piece, each “Shoelace Rug” anyway. Designed by Nate Siverstein and Andrea Paustenbaugh.
